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7540 0696 5352253753
3285 58265000
3285 58265000
92884 5447 56343843 13262
All about undefined
Interested in learning more?
3285 58265000
92884 5447 56343843 13262
See more
040769 1787 277045
186858849 358479822 07305843374
See more
6233265732 1326344500 9744
47321102391 40 775 36
See more